TrainerRoad's Big Data

The TR data set is really strong on workout-specific data (Power, HR, cadence data etc.), but weak on “big picture” type data.

So, why don’t TR send out a survey to all users to aim to collect such data as:

  • How many years they’ve been cycling.
  • What their cycling background is (road, TT, MTB etc.).
  • What other training they carry out, plus the volume for each discipline.
  • Typical diet (if on LCHF etc.).

If enough data is collected, some useful trends might start to emerge (when tied with the workout data)… experienced cyclists respond better to plans x/y/z. Those cyclists on a LCHF diet are getting more gains from certain plans. If you’ve got a big road cycling background certain plans aren’t very effective etc…

No-one likes completing surveys, but if there’s a decent prize at stake (win a smart trainer, or a free year TR subscription) then enough people are likely to complete it :slight_smile:

Based on this data, TR could implement a new “Plan Builder” option into the website; so instead of selecting an off-the-shelf plan, you’d complete a series of questions (required phase / available training hours per week / training experience & background / diet etc.) that would generate a custom plan for you… all based on what the data has shown as been most effective for you.

As time goes on this “big picture” data set would become more and more comprehensive (based on the data collected in the “Plan Builder”), leading to better custom plans.
